Output 08f76bed3c63d770bd0697b1a94fd4f7384f8a22449701a339adc887751e0c0a:0

value
905000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f376361967b348b0c4498d68cccd92a734403a OP_EQUAL
address
3BMEXhtZLKU87Poi15Q7r3okwdYKHdjfPF
transaction
08f76bed3c63d770bd0697b1a94fd4f7384f8a22449701a339adc887751e0c0a
spent
true